Encryption Technologies

One of the foremost pillars of banking security in online casinos is the implementation of advanced encryption technologies. These protocols are critical in safeguarding player data during transactions.

  • SSL Encryption: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ption is the industry standard for securing data transfers. It ensures that all sensitive information, such as credit card numbers and personal details, is encrypted before transmission.
  • TLS Protocols: Transport Layer Security (TLS) builds upon SSL and offers enhanced protection against eavesdropping and tampering, crucial for maintaining the integrity of financial transactions.
  • End-to-End Encryption: This method encrypts data at its origin and only decrypts it at its destination, ensuring that not even the casino can access player information during the transaction process.

Regulatory Compliance

Compliance with regulatory standards adds an additional layer of confidence for high-rollers. Online casinos must adhere to strict guidelines to ensure fair play and secure banking practices.

  • Licensing Bodies: Reputable casinos are licensed by esteemed regulatory authorities such as the UK Gambling Commission and the Malta Gaming Authority. These organizations enforce rigorous standards for financial transactions and data protection.
  • Regular Audits: Compliance with regulations often requires regular audits by independent third parties. These audits assess the casino’s security measures, ensuring they are robust and effective.
  • Player Protection Policies: Many jurisdictions mandate that casinos implement responsible gaming measures, including self-exclusion options and limits on deposits to protect high-stakes players from financial harm.

Secure Payment Methods

The choice of payment methods available at an online casino significantly influences the overall security experience. High-rollers often favor options that provide both convenience and enhanced security.

  • Credit and Debit Cards: Major card providers like Visa and MasterCard offer robust fraud protection and easy chargeback processes, which can be invaluable for high-stakes players.
  • E-Wallets: Platforms such as PayPal, Neteller, and Skrill are popular among seasoned gamblers due to their layered security features, including two-factor authentication.
  • Cryptocurrency: Digital currencies such as Bitcoin offer anonymity and secure transactions, appealing to players who prioritize privacy alongside security.
